Carl-Gustav Groth Xeno Prize

Andrew Adams

Professor of Surgery, University of Minnesota, Minneapolis, United States
IXA members are eligible for the Carl-Gustav Groth Xeno Prize. This prize of US $7,000 is jointly sponsored by the International Xenotransplantation Association (IXA) and the publisher of Xenotransplantation (Wiley). The Xeno Prize will be awarded to the first author of the best paper published in the journal Xenotransplantation each calendar year.
